French actress Juliette Binoche is in Karlovy Vary ahead of Saturday's closing ceremony, where she will receive the Crystal Globe for Outstanding Artistic Contribution to World Cinema. On Thursday, the Oscar-winning actress will present two films: the documentary essay In Us, which she directed, and Certified Copy, in which she stars.
Czech President Petr Pavel is also due to visit the Karlovy Vary International Film Festival. He is scheduled to attend a screening of the Czech film Whisper (Šeptej), before meeting Czech filmmakers later in the day.

Czechia will not contribute to the €70 billion in military aid for Ukraine pledged by NATO allies, Prime Minister Andrej Babiš said after the Alliance's summit in Ankara on Wednesday.
Speaking to journalists before leaving Turkey, Babiš said Europe should focus on strengthening air defence against ballistic missiles. He also reiterated that Czech defence spending will reach 2 percent of GDP next year, while saying meeting that target this year remains unlikely. He added that he had spoken with US President Donald Trump on Tuesday evening and again briefly on Wednesday.
NATO allies pledged to provide Ukraine with €70 billion in military equipment, assistance and training this year and to maintain the same level of support in 2027, according to the summit's final declaration.

Linda Nosková reached her first Grand Slam semifinal on Wednesday after defeating Elise Mertens 6-3, 7-5 in the Wimbledon quarterfinals.
The 21-year-old will face Marta Kostyuk for a place in the final on Thursday. She joins fellow Czech Karolína Muchová, who advanced to her first Wimbledon semifinal on Tuesday with a 7-6 (7-4), 6-4 victory over Naomi Osaka.
It is the first time since 2014 that two Czech women have reached the Wimbledon singles semifinals, when Petra Kvitová and Lucie Šafářová made the last four, keeping alive the prospect of an all-Czech final.

Czech water rescuers have responded to more than 420 incidents so far this summer, nearly half the total recorded during last year's entire season. According to the Water Rescue Service of the Czech Red Cross, the sharp increase is due to the hot weather in recent weeks.
A total of 165 people drowned in Czechia last year. Although prevention campaigns have helped reduce the annual death toll in recent years, it remains high compared with many Western European countries.
The rescue service also uses an underwater drone that can dive to depths of up to 100 metres. It helps inspect waterways, document boating accidents and assist police in searching for drowning victims.

A Ukrainian man born in former Czechoslovakia is among two suspects arrested in connection with last week's bombing in Monaco, Ukrainian media reported on Wednesday.
According to the Ukrainian anti-corruption outlet Antikor, the suspect, identified as Yevhen Reun, was born in former Czechoslovakia in 1986. He and another man have been charged with the murder of Anastasiia Berezovska, who was suspected of planting the bomb that seriously injured Ukrainian businessman Vadym Yermolayev and his partner.
Investigators are trying to establish who ordered the bombing. Berezovska's body was found near Kyiv on Monday, and prosecutors say she was shot dead. One of the suspects has reportedly confessed to the killing.

Prime Minister Andrej Babiš held a series of bilateral meetings with the leaders of the Netherlands, Slovakia, Bulgaria and Slovenia on the sidelines of the 2026 NATO Summit in Ankara on Wednesday.
According to the Bulgarian government, Babiš and Bulgarian Prime Minister Rumen Radev discussed expanding cooperation in defence and energy, as well as the impact of Russia's war in Ukraine and energy diversification in Central and Eastern Europe.
President Petr Pavel is also attending the summit, where he has been holding separate bilateral talks focused on defence spending, support for Ukraine and closer European defence cooperation.

Despite growing boat traffic on Czech waterways, the number of boating accidents has remained stable, according to figures released by the State Navigation Administration on Wednesday. The authority recorded 21 accidents last year and six so far this year, none of them serious.
The number of recreational vessels has roughly doubled in recent years, prompting increased police patrols on rivers and reservoirs. Officers are focusing on prevention and enforcing navigation rules.
More than 71,000 people in Czechia are now licensed to operate small recreational vessels, with around 3,500 new licences issued each year.

Electricity consumption in Czechia continued to grow in the second quarter of this year despite rising prices, according to an analysis by energy company Amper Meteo. Weather-adjusted electricity use was up 2.3 percent year on year, while electricity prices increased by 26 percent.
Despite the recent growth, electricity consumption remains 5.5 percent below the average recorded before the energy crisis. Gas consumption also remains lower than pre-crisis levels, although it rose slightly compared with the same period last year.
Solar power remained Czechia's largest renewable electricity source, accounting for more than three-quarters of renewable generation so far this year. Together with hydro and wind power, renewables covered just over 10 percent of the country's electricity consumption.

Karolína Muchová has reached her first Wimbledon semifinal after defeating Naomi Osaka 7-6 (7-4), 6-4 on Tuesday. The victory came just over a week after Muchová also beat Osaka in the final of the Bad Homburg tournament.
The win makes Muchová the eighth active player to have reached the women's singles semifinals at all four Grand Slam tournaments. She is also only the fourth Czech woman in the Open Era to achieve the feat.
Muchová joins former Czech greats Hana Mandlíková, Jana Novotná and Karolína Plíšková in reaching the semifinals of all four Grand Slams.
